Bespoke Desk Solution | Tailored Desks for Workspaces

A custom desk is more than just a surface to work on — it’s a tailored solution designed to meet your specific needs, space, and style. Whether you’re setting up in a business setting, improving your home office, or designing flexible multi‑use space, made‑to‑order desks provide a level of personalization and functionality that store‑bought options simply can’t match. From the selection of wood, metal or laminate to color, size and tech‑features, each detail is intentional.

One of the most important benefits of a custom desk is its ability to fit perfectly into any space. Standard desks often fall short — either too big for a room, too small for your workflow, or lacking essential storage. With a made‑to‑order approach, your desk is built to precise dimensions, ensuring that it complements the room layout and maximizes efficiency. Whether it's a compact desk tucked under a staircase, a corner workstation, or a large executive surface with built‑in cabinetry, the design is guided entirely by your available space and intended use.

Functionality is where custom desks truly shine. These workspaces are built around your day‑to‑day activities. Need integrated monitor arms, rising desk surfaces, or extended platforms for design work? Want integrated drawers, keyboard trays, or hidden cable management? All of this is possible with a custom design. Your desk can include embedded tech features, cable ports, wireless charging, and ambient or task lighting — features that streamline your work, reduce mess, and improve efficiency.

In shared or multi‑use environments, a made‑to‑order desk can do double duty. For example, a home office may also serve as a multi‑purpose room for work and leisure. A custom desk with hidden leaves, folding panels, or sliding tops can easily transition between day job and hobbies. Wall‑mounted, floating, or L‑shaped desk designs further increase the flexibility of your space, especially when paired with custom shelving or built‑in cabinetry.

Ergonomics play a major role in the design of a custom desk. An wrong height, depth, or clearance can make working unpleasant or even harmful. A tailored desk is built with your measurements and comfort preferences, from the height of the desktop to the depth of your work surface and positioning of accessories. Designers take into account your preferred chair height, monitor position, and even your dominant hand when planning drawer placement and access points.

The choice of materials and finishes allows your custom desk to reflect your aesthetic identity. From rich woods, sleek metals, or engineered composites, the look and feel of your desk can be crafted to suit warm‑classic, modern, or clean minimalist styles. Custom stains, matte or gloss finishes, and decorative hardware options further personalize the desk to match your brand, interior décor, or mood of the space.

Durability is another reason to choose a custom‑built desk. Many mass‑produced desks use thin boards, weak fasteners, and cheap hardware that fail under daily use. In contrast, made‑to‑order desks are often crafted with long‑lasting, high‑quality materials and expert joinery. Whether it’s hardwood build, steel support, or robust joinery at stress points, your desk is built to stand up to years of daily use without wobbling, sagging, or peeling.

In a business setting, a custom desk can also reflect your corporate style. Executive desks, reception stations, and communal work surfaces can be designed to align with your company’s color palette, logo, and overall vibe. Matching built‑in storage, paneling, and even custom signage can create a cohesive, elevated look that leaves a lasting impression on clients and employees alike.

Sustainability is a growing concern in modern workspace design, and many custom furniture makers offer eco‑friendly options for desks. This might include the use of certified sustainable timber, non‑toxic coatings, or reclaimed elements. Supporting local or small‑scale craftsmen also helps reduce environmental impact while promoting ethical production standards.

Security and privacy features can be built into your custom desk as well. Lockable drawers, concealed compartments, or even integrated safes are useful for professionals who manage sensitive documents or valuable equipment. These features are seamlessly integrated to preserve the clean lines and design integrity of the piece while offering peace of mind.

Another benefit of custom desks is their adaptability over time. With modular design options, your desk can be modified or expanded in the future. Whether your needs change — like adding new equipment or shifting to remote work full‑time — your desk can evolve with you, without requiring a full replacement.

Working with a professional furniture designer or custom builder opens up a world of possibilities. Their expertise ensures that your desk is not only visually appealing but also deeply functional and perfectly tailored to you. From digital renderings and material samples to installation and finishing touches, every stage of the process is personalized.

In the end, a custom desk isn’t just a piece of furniture — it’s a foundational part of your daily environment. It aligns with your routines, echoes who you are, and helps shape a workspace where inspiration and performance meet. Whether you’re designing a home office built for focus and comfort or furnishing a corporate environment with presence, made‑to‑order desks deliver precision, performance, and a sense of purpose in every detail.
